Why does local dating work differently in Taunton?

Local dating works best in Taunton when matches reflect practical travel, not just a broad Somerset label.

A radius looks neat on a screen. Real life is messier. The M5 can make some journeys straightforward, while an apparently short trip along slower roads can take more effort than expected. If neither person drives, proximity to Taunton railway station or a sensible bus route may matter more than mileage.

A useful match is not merely nearby on a map. They are close enough that meeting again would not feel like organising a day trip.

Be honest about your workable area. If you would happily meet someone in Wellington but not regularly travel towards Bath, say so. That is not being fussy. It saves both people time and keeps the focus on connections that could function outside the chat window.

A first meeting does not need candles, a tasting menu or a carefully engineered sunset. In fact, less pressure usually helps. Taunton has enough central, public places to make a short first meeting easy, with options to continue if conversation is flowing.

Where can you go on a first date in Taunton?

Good first-date places in Taunton include Vivary Park, the Museum of Somerset and central cafés near the town centre.

Vivary Park is close to the centre and gives you room to walk without committing to a long outing. The Museum of Somerset, housed in Taunton Castle, offers natural things to talk about when direct conversation needs a breather. The Brewhouse Theatre and Arts Centre at Coal Orchard can work well for a later date, especially when you already know that you share an interest in live performance, comedy or exhibitions.

The best choice depends on what makes both people comfortable. A walk can feel easy and informal, but some people prefer sitting opposite each other somewhere warm and busy. Ask. A simple question such as “Would you rather get coffee or have a wander around the museum?” is considerate without turning the arrangement into a committee meeting.

  • Keep it central. A familiar public location is easier to find and usually offers several ways to get home.
  • Set a modest plan. Coffee is enough. If things go well, you can add a walk through Goodland Gardens or arrange another date.
  • Check access. Consider parking, public transport, mobility needs and closing times before suggesting a venue.

Profiles often become vague because people are trying not to rule anyone out. The result is a page full of agreeable words that could belong to almost anybody. “I like nights out and nights in” says very little. A useful profile gives another person an easy, genuine opening.

How do you write a Taunton dating profile that gets better conversations?

A strong dating profile combines recent photographs, specific interests and an honest description of where and how you live.

  1. Choose clear photographs. Use a recent main picture in good light, without sunglasses or a group of friends making it difficult to identify you.
  2. Name real interests. Replace “I enjoy the outdoors” with something concrete, whether that means walking on the Quantocks, gardening, following Somerset cricket or browsing local exhibitions.
  3. Describe your routine. Mention whether weekends are usually free, whether you work shifts, and how far you are realistically prepared to travel.
  4. Give people a starting point. Include a small question or detail that invites a reply, such as asking for a favourite Sunday lunch place or an easy local walk.
  5. Read it once for accuracy. Remove old references, check your location and make sure the profile still sounds like you.

Profile tip: Write for the person you would enjoy meeting, not for an imaginary crowd. Two specific sentences about your real week are worth more than a long list of flattering adjectives.

Age does not change this principle. Someone dating again after a long relationship does not need to apologise for being out of practice. Nor does a person in their twenties need to perform constant spontaneity. Plain facts are attractive because they make intentions easier to understand.

Most first conversations are ordinary and sincere. Even so, caution belongs in the process from the start. Scammers rely on speed, emotional pressure and a reluctance to check details. Genuine people generally understand why trust takes time.

Is online dating in Taunton safe?

Online dating can be approached safely by protecting personal information, watching for pressure and keeping first meetings public.

No site can promise that every stranger is trustworthy. Safety is more like locking your front door than building a fortress: a few consistent habits remove many avoidable risks without making every conversation feel suspicious.

  • Keep early chats on the site. Moving immediately to private messaging gives away contact details and removes useful reporting tools.
  • Protect identifying information. Do not share your home address, workplace, banking details or answers commonly used for security questions.
  • Look for consistency. Details about work, location and daily life should make sense over time. One clumsy message proves little; repeated contradictions deserve attention.
  • Arrange your own transport. For a first meeting, arrive independently and keep control of when you leave.
  • Tell somebody. Give a friend or relative the venue, time and profile details, then check in afterwards.

Stop if money enters the conversation. Never send cash, gift cards, cryptocurrency, bank transfers or account access to someone you know only through dating messages, whatever emergency they describe.

Privacy concerns can be more personal in a county town. You may worry about colleagues, an ex or neighbours seeing your profile. Avoid naming a small employer or village if that would identify you too precisely. You can describe your area more broadly until trust develops. If a profile makes you uneasy, use the block and report controls rather than debating with the person.
